If adding the dinput8.dll file does not resolve the issue, try these alternative, highly effective methods. Method A: Install SilentPatch (Recommended)
You will see files like:
When this happens, the cursor either freezes entirely, stops registering clicks, or disappears completely when escaping to the pause menu. What is the Mouse Fix .zip Archive? gta san andreas windows 88110 mouse fixzip
After applying these fixes, you may notice that your mouse feels different—perhaps faster or more sensitive than before. This is normal because the enhanced input methods capture more data per second. Simply adjust your mouse sensitivity in the GTA: San Andreas options menu until it feels right.
Locate your GTA San Andreas installation folder (where gta_sa.exe is) and paste the dinput8.dll file there. If adding the dinput8
C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to San Andreas
The file is a community-created package that resolves these input hangs. It typically contains a modified Dynamic Link Library ( .dll ) file or an input modification script designed to intercept and correct the data flow between Windows and the game engine. The most common files included in these fixes are: After applying these fixes, you may notice that
Start with the DINPUT8.dll fix, as it solves the issue for most players. If that doesn't work, or if you want the most comprehensive solution possible, install SilentPatch alongside it. Remember to run the game in compatibility mode as an administrator, and adjust your CPU affinity if necessary.
How to Fix the Mouse Not Working in GTA San Andreas on Windows 8, 8.1, and 10
: Right-click your GTA San Andreas shortcut and select "Open file location" to find the main directory where gta_sa.exe resides.
This method works because certain Windows processes can interfere with older games. One user noted that this is a "step-by-step solution" that some players find effective.